Criterion 1 – Transparency: Are the Costs and Rules Clear?
The first thing any experienced slot player looks for is honesty about what you are buying. In high-volatility slots, the feature-buy amount is usually set at 50× to 100× the base bet, but that number alone does not tell you the value. You need to know the number of free spins awarded, the minimum and maximum multiplier per spin, and whether the feature can retrigger during the bonus. On Sunwin, some games show this information in a small pop-up when you hover over the “Buy Feature” button, others require you to open the paytable from the main menu. That inconsistency matters.
From community observations, players report that games developed by certain providers on the platform display the expected RTP for the feature-buy separately – often higher than the base-game RTP. However, that figure is not always confirmed in the game’s own help section. I have not personally seen a written license or certified RTP report for Sunwin, so treat any such number as a claim to be verified independently if you can. What is clear is that the cost in credits is shown upfront, and the number of spins awarded is stated before confirmation. That meets a basic transparency threshold, but a more detailed breakdown (e.g., average return per purchased feature) would be better for informed decision-making.

Criterion 2 – Speed of Transaction: Does the Bonus Start Instantly?
After you confirm the purchase, the ideal experience is zero lag. The balance should deduct within one second, the reels should spin automatically into the bonus round, and you should not see any spinning wheel or “loading…” screen. In my observation of demo sessions, the transaction completed nearly instantaneously on a stable Wi-Fi connection. However, player reports I have read mention occasional delays of 5–10 seconds during peak hours, especially on weekends. That might be due to server load rather than a design flaw, but for someone who values speed, any pause can feel like an eternity.
Another speed-related issue is the animation after the purchase. Some high-volatility slots play a transitional animation before the free spins begin. That is cosmetic, not a transaction delay, but it adds to the total time between payment and first free spin. If you are on a mobile device with lower processing power, that animation can stutter. For a platform that aims at convenience, minimising these milliseconds would be a smart upgrade.

Criterion 4 – Security: What Protects Your Purchase?
When you press that confirm button, your balance drops immediately. Security in this context covers two angles: transactional integrity (your money is actually deducted for the intended feature) and personal data protection. From what I have gathered, Sunwin uses encrypted connections for all payment-related actions. The feature-buy itself does not require additional identity verification – your account session is enough – which is normal for in-game purchases. However, this also means that if your account is compromised, someone could buy free spins using your balance. Two-factor authentication for purchases above a certain threshold would be a sensible addition, but I have not seen that option.
Another security point: after the purchase, your transaction appears in the game history log, showing the amount deducted and the time. That helps if you need to dispute a failed credit. I have not come across widespread reports of purchased free spins not activating, but a few isolated forum posts mention that the bonus started with fewer spins than stated. The support team resolved those cases after the player provided screenshots – which brings us to the next criterion.

Remember that buying free spins increases your effective bet size and accelerates your bankroll burn. High-volatility slots can produce long losing streaks even inside the bonus round. Always play within comfortable limits and never chase losses through repeated feature-buys.
